Stable denitrification through targeted addition of carbon sources
The right ratio of carbon, nitrogen and phosphorus is crucial for efficient nitrogen elimination. Only if the microorganisms are sufficiently supplied with easily biodegradable carbon compounds can denitrification run reliably and stably.
Dosing challenges
- Unfavourable nutrient ratios impair the biological degradation performance.
- Inaccurate dosing leads to increased chemical consumption and higher operating costs.
- Underdosing can lead to incomplete denitrification and poorer effluent values.
